Output e38af25e83f8b153f41201c737b8d909760f71483bcb32541227a18f74117afc:1

value
7996649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49851398bd5b7f6ea8a3f8d5a80e68aa5f5ead3b OP_EQUAL
address
38PkfsJd1tc7rbYgaFVDMkid5JeBzw2AUh
transaction
e38af25e83f8b153f41201c737b8d909760f71483bcb32541227a18f74117afc